James Lavish, a Federal Reserve expert, joins the conversation to dissect the Fed's latest interest rate decisions and the implications of quantitative easing. He highlights the alarming U.S. debt levels and how they may lead to economic turmoil. The discussion also probes the repo market, revealing the Fed's disconnect from current inflation trends. Lavish emphasizes hard assets like Bitcoin and gold as potential safe havens amidst fiscal uncertainty. The complexities of the Fed's monetary strategies and their effect on market confidence are thoroughly explored.

Quick takeaways

  • The Federal Reserve's recent decision to cut interest rates aims to prevent a potential deflationary crisis amid rising unemployment and high inflation rates.
  • The United States' soaring annual deficits and overall debt illustrate a precarious financial scenario akin to a 'zombie company,' necessitating urgent reform despite political challenges.

The Role of the Fed and Treasury in Maintaining Dollar Confidence

The Fed and the Treasury aim to maintain confidence in the dollar to ensure the continued sale of US Treasuries, crucial for funding the country's substantial deficits, which exceed $2 trillion annually. A decline in confidence could result in a deflationary crisis, leading to increased unemployment and reduced investment in Treasuries, thereby worsening the financial situation. Maintaining stable pricing and low unemployment is vital for these institutions, as their primary focus is preventing destabilization in the Treasury market. Their inability to stop running massive deficits, even in non-recession periods, underscores the delicate balance they must maintain.
